Calculate the molecular masses of the following compounds :
Ethene, C2H4
(Atomic masses : C = 12 u ; H = 1 u)

उत्तर
Given:
Atomic mass of C = 12 u
Atomic mass of H = 1 u
Therefore, molecular mass of C2H4 (ethylene) can be calculated as follows:
(2 × 12) + (4 × 1) = 28
Hence, molecular mass of ethylene is 28 u.
